The Future of Cities: How Artificial Intelligence Will Shape and Challenge Urban Life

Cities have always been the epicenters of human innovation and progress. As we venture further into the 21st century, the future of cities is being redefined by an unlikely ally - artificial intelligence (AI). AI is poised to transform urban landscapes in ways that were once the stuff of science fiction, promising improved efficiency, sustainability, and quality of life. However, as we embrace this brave new world, we must also confront the potential challenges and ethical concerns AI brings to the urban equation.

The Promise of AI in Cities

  1. Smart Infrastructure and Efficiency AI's most immediate impact on cities is in optimizing infrastructure. AI-powered systems can monitor and manage energy consumption, traffic flow, waste management, and water supply more efficiently than ever before.   2. Urban Mobility The future of transportation in cities is undergoing a dramatic transformation thanks to AI. Self-driving cars, ride-sharing services, and AI-driven public transit systems promise to reduce congestion, lower accident rates, and improve the overall mobility experience for residents.   3. Healthcare and Safety AI can enhance healthcare delivery and public safety. Predictive analytics can help city authorities anticipate disease outbreaks, allocate resources more effectively during emergencies, and enhance law enforcement efforts through predictive policing.   4. Sustainability AI can aid in achieving sustainability goals by optimizing energy usage, managing waste, and promoting eco-friendly practices. Smart grids, for example, can dynamically adjust energy distribution based on real-time data, reducing both costs and environmental impact.   5. Urban Planning AI can help urban planners make more informed decisions by analyzing vast amounts of data on demographics, traffic patterns, and environmental factors. This can lead to better-designed and more livable cities. Challenges and Concerns

  1. Data Privacy and Surveillance The widespread deployment of AI in cities raises concerns about data privacy and surveillance. As cities collect and analyze more data on residents, there's a risk of encroaching on personal privacy. Striking a balance between security and individual freedoms will be a crucial challenge.
  2. Job Displacement As AI automates various tasks and industries, cities may face significant job displacement. Preparing the workforce for AI-driven changes and creating new job opportunities will be essential to mitigate economic disparities.
  3. Bias and Discrimination AI algorithms can inherit biases present in their training data, potentially perpetuating discrimination in areas like law enforcement, housing, and employment. Ensuring fairness and equity in AI systems is a complex ethical challenge.
  4. Security Vulnerabilities As cities become more dependent on AI for critical infrastructure, they become more susceptible to cyberattacks. Ensuring the security of AI systems is paramount to protect the well-being of urban populations.
  5. Technological Divide Smaller cities and underdeveloped regions may struggle to adopt and implement AI solutions, exacerbating the urban-rural technological divide.

Conclusion

The future of cities is undeniably intertwined with artificial intelligence. While AI holds the promise of creating smarter, more efficient, and sustainable urban environments, it also brings forth a set of challenges that demand careful consideration. Striking the right balance between harnessing AI's potential and safeguarding human values and rights will be the defining task of urban planners, policymakers, and technologists in the coming years. By addressing these challenges proactively, we can hope to build cities that are not only technologically advanced but also more inclusive, equitable, and responsive to the needs of their residents in this AI-driven future.
